1
Q

Definition: Any change made to a member’s expected work record in the timekeeping system.

A

Exception Entry

2
Q

Definition: A pre-assigned work schedule for the entire work period or work year for each member, as generated by the designated timekeeping system.

A

Expected Work Record

3
Q

Definition: A fixed and regularly recurring period of time consisting of 14, consecutive, 24-hour periods beginning at 0001 hours on a specified Sunday and ending at 2400 hours on the following second Saturday.

A

Pay Period

4
Q

Definition: Department forms, letters, and memorandums used for supporting exception entries.

A

Source Document

5
Q

Definition: A period of time that elapses between the beginning and the conclusion of the regular hours of assignment, when a member is regularly scheduled to be on duty or stationed at a prescribed place.

A

Tour of Duty

6
Q

Definition: A fixed and regularly recurring period of time consisting of 28 consecutive days beginning at 0001 hours on a specified Sunday and ending at 2400 hours on the following fourth Saturday.

A

Work Period

7
Q

Definition: An established and recurring period of time consisting of 364 consecutive days beginning at 0001 hours on a specified Sunday and ending at 2400 hours on the following 52nd Saturday.

A

Work Year
